Karnataka Tourism Society (KTS) is organizing a B2B Roadshow Series in Central India from January 27-31.
The roadshow will cover five cities: Indore, Nagpur, Aurangabad, Nashik, and Pune.
The objective is to build direct business connections with travel agents, tour operators, and hospitality partners.
KTS aims to promote Karnataka as a diverse, all-season destination with a focus on eco-tourism, rural tourism, wildlife, and wellness travel.
The initiative is led by K Syama Raju, President of KTS, with support from other executive committee members.
